Sprockets from Cast Iron : Rugged Strength for Demanding Applications
In the realm of industrial machinery, where strength is paramount, cast iron sprockets emerge as a stalwart solution. Fabricated from top-tier cast iron alloy, these sprockets exhibit exceptional resistance to wear and tear, ensuring reliable performance even under the most demanding conditions.
The inherent hardness of cast iron grants these sprockets the ability to withstand heavy loads and pressure. This makes them ideal for a wide range of applications, including conveyors, where reliable power transmission is essential. Moreover, cast iron sprockets offer excellent corrosion resistance , ensuring longevity even in challenging operating environments.
When specifying a sprocket for your application, consider factors such as load capacity, speed, and environmental conditions. Consulting a qualified engineer can help you select the optimal cast iron sprocket to meet your specific needs.

Robust Farm Sprockets
In the demanding realm of industrial agriculture, heavy-duty sprockets operate as vital components in a variety of applications. These transmit power from drives to belts, enabling the smooth and productive operation of agricultural machinery. Sprockets are constructed from strong materials such as steel or cast iron to withstand the rigors of heavy-duty use in fields, orchards, and various farming environments.
- Key attributes of heavy-duty sprockets include their strength, precise tooth geometry, and rust resistance.
- Choosing the right size and type of sprocket is essential to ensure optimal functionality.
- Maintenance of sprockets involves regular reviews for damage, and efficient replacement when needed.
Advanced Fabrication of Agricultural Sprockets
Agriculture depends on reliable machinery to ensure efficient and productive operations. Amidst the many critical components that power these machines, agricultural sprockets play a vital role in transmitting power between various systems. In order to maximize output, precise engineering techniques are essential in the manufacturing of these crucial components.
Cutting-edge precision engineering employs sophisticated tools and processes to create sprockets with outstanding accuracy and durability. This covers techniques such as Computer-Aided Design (CAD), Computer-Aided Manufacturing (CAM), and ultra-fine machining. These methods enable the creation of sprockets with close tolerances, promising smooth function and eliminating wear and tear.
Furthermore, precision engineering allows for the incorporation of unique features engineered to meet the unique requirements of different agricultural applications. This includes variations in tooth profile, fine-tuned for maximum power transmission and load distribution.
Through the ongoing advancements in precision engineering, agricultural sprockets are becoming increasingly reliable, efficient, and long-lasting. This contributes to the overall productivity and sustainability of the agricultural industry.
